Best time to go to Caldbeck

The best time to visit Caldbeck is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.1°F (3.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
February38.7°F (3.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
March40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April44.6°F (7.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May49.5°F (9.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
September54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
October49.3°F (9.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December39.7°F (4.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ather like in Caldbeck?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Caldbeck is 1633 mm.
